40 V, 12 mOhm bi-directional Gallium Nitride (GaN) FET in a 1.2 mm x 1.7 mm Wafer Level Chip-Scale Package (WLCSP)

The GANB012-040CBA is a 40 V, 12 mΩ bi-directional Gallium Nitride (GaN) High Electron-Mobility-Transistor (HEMT) in a Wafer Level Chip-Scale (WLCSP) package. It is a normally-off e-mode device offering superior performance.

Product details

Features and benefits

  • Enhancement mode - normally-off power switch

  • Bi-directional device

  • Ultra high switching speed capability

  • Ultra-low on-state resistance

  • RoHS, Pb-free, REACH-compliant

  • High efficiency and high power density

  • Wafer Level Chip-Scale Package (WLCSP) 1.2 mm x 1.7 mm

Applications

  • High-side load switch

  • OVP protection in smart phone USB port

  • DC-to-DC converters

  • Power switch circuits

  • Stand-by power system
